even i had the same problem, but i found that the AD_LINK connector was not properly connected to the soundcard. It may seem to get connected but even with a slight pull it comes out. The cabinet metal strips at the back obstruct the connector and it doesnt get connected properly.wat i did was, before installing the CARD on to the slot, i connected the AD_LINK first and then put it in the slot.
This problem generally doesnt occur with the FIREWIRE connector as theres plenty of room above and below the connetor. and so ur IO Box is Powering UP but fails to communicate with the sound card.

    How do I know if the external box works at all?
    I've installed all software and drivers after the box was connected to the internal card with the bundeled cable.
    I have no light on the external box.
    Line-In and Headphone are dead.
    What can be wrong?

    There should be a light coming out of the Optical Out, if you remove the little black button/cover in it.
    There should be the external cable of course going to the external dri'vebay, but you should also have a power cable connected internally. You can check the connections in the manual, there is a diagram that lists these and where to find them. If all the cables are connected properly and it still doesn't work, I would suggest trying to disconnect another device, such as a DVD-ROM or extra harddri've, in case the power supply isn't strong enough.
    Otherwise it's possible there is a (hardware) problem with the dri've or one of the cables. Contact Customer Support for further assistance, and they'll be happy to go over the configuration with you to see what could be causing the problem.

    FCP will not unsqueeze the image for you...you need a monitor that has this option.
    what will we use to replace NTSC monitors if you're shooting and editing HD?
    And HD monitor. But then you need some sort of HD capture card or output device (unless you are working with DVCPRO HD)...even HDV. And then you will need an HD monitor. The cheapest solution might be the Decklink Intensity and small HDTV...the intensity has HDMI out. But this only works if you have a MacPro. The MATROX MXO is next, and it connects via DVI. It can output a signal to an HDTV (component), or to an Apple Cinema Display or Dell 24" Display. That gets you broadcast quality on a computer monitor...believe it, or not!
